sticky-fudge concept store



for those who have not had the opportunity to see sticky-fudge's first concept store, here is look at what you can expect.

local concept, local designs, proudly south african

you'll find the shop in tyger valley mall, situated close by woolworths and the 
soon-to-be-there zara. its tiny, but you wont miss it.

here's what i love about sticky-fudge:
they custom design their own tiles for their shop. (bunny ears, spectacles and braces!)
they never leave a detail unscrutinised, (have you seen the postcard & jewellery!) 
they have a globally relevant vision (sold in 23 countries around the world!)
and i just love their old world charm! (voted as 1 of the top 5 brands by WGSN-thats massive!) 

the brand is divided into three categories, namely trusted, trendy and tailored, in which you'll get your basics, fashion items and the all-glorious hand crafted tailored items. prices range from R180 - R898. they cater for newborns to 7 year olds.

2014 spring/summer preview






we have a good spread of tropical prints, outdoor-adventures, nautical trends and cool colours, to look forward to over the next few months. loads of accessories, such as backpacks and bandannas, give us more things to play with. one thing is guaranteed; summer rompers/onesey’s are here to stay! some brands have become smarter, and some bolder! all in                                   all, it’s looking very good and we have a lot to choose from.

brands included in this preview, in alphabetical order:
country road kids, earthchild, naartjie and sticky-fudge

2014 fall/winter preview






here's a glimpse of what we can expect in stores from, in alphabetical order:
earthchild, naartjie & sticky-fudge.
(also including their size breakdowns)


the highlights are that we can expect modern shaped trousers from all the brands, tailored twill coats for girls, african inspired infant wear, victorian inspired bibs for babies, and lovely winter boots. if i’m not mistaken in april there are also some desert boots coming our way again.
